Qu'est-ce qu'elles sont, comment elles fonctionnent et principales fonctions de ces couches supplémentaires pour les modèles d'intelligence artificielle
Nous allons vous expliquer ce qu'est le , une sorte de couche qui se place au-dessus des modèles d'intelligence artificielle, comme le langage LLM. Ainsi, lorsque vous lirez que nous mentionnons que telle ou telle IA est en réalité un wrapper, vous saurez ce que nous voulons dire.
Essayons de rendre cet article court et compréhensible. Nous expliquerons d’abord de manière simple et avec des exemples ce qu’est un wrapper, puis nous vous expliquerons certaines de ses principales fonctions.
Que sont les AI Wrappers et comment fonctionnent-ils ?
Les wrappers d’intelligence artificielle sont des applications ou des interfaces qui facilitent l’utilisation d’un modèle d’intelligence artificielle. Il ne s’agit pas d’un nouveau modèle, mais simplement d’une interface qui utilise comme base des modèles existants pour les personnaliser.
Ces wrappers sont donc des couches plus conviviales qui sont placées au-dessus d'un modèle tiers pour faciliter leur utilisation dans des contextes spécifiques. Cette couche est généralement constituée d'une interface, d'un ensemble de règles et d'un contexte qui est appliqué à l'IA à chaque fois que vous l'utilisez.
En général et pour simplifier grandement, nous pouvons penser à deux types courants de wrappers. Il y a d’abord ceux qui font que le modèle d’IA sert une fonctionnalité spécifique, en le spécialisant dans cette direction avec le contexte qui lui est donné.
Mais ensuite nous en avons d'autres qui sont plus simples, ce sont simplement des chatbots comme ChatGPT ou Gemini, mais ils agissent comme un wrapper avec GPT ou Gemini afin que la réponse du modèle soit différente, meilleure, plus fine ou écrite d'une autre manière.
Vous souvenez-vous il y a des années lorsque Microsoft a annoncé Copilot, sa propre IA basée sur le même modèle GPT que celui utilisé par ChatGPT ? Eh bien, ce qu'était Copilot au début était un wrapper, une version de GPT modifiée par Microsoft pour que les réponses soient différentes. Les capacités étaient les mêmes, mais les réponses étaient différentes.
Ainsi, un wrapper n’est pas une intelligence artificielle dotée de son propre moteur de langage formé à partir de zéro. C'est une IA qui utilise le moteur linguistique des autres mais modifié pour avoir des caractéristiques ou des résultats spécifiques.
Les wrappers peuvent être gratuits ou payants, cela dépendra de chacun des services. Et bien que dans les exemples nous ayons presque toujours fait référence aux chatbots textuels, ils peuvent également être utilisés pour créer des images, étant des applications qui utilisent des modèles d'autres pour créer des images avec des filtres ou des designs spécifiques.
Fonctions d'emballage
Les wrappers ont de nombreux objectifs et fonctions, tels que le retraitement des données avant de les envoyer au modèle. Ils peuvent le faire en corrigeant les fautes d’orthographe ou en enrichissant les informations que nous avons fournies afin que la réponse soit meilleure.
En ce sens, ils peuvent également donner un contexte supplémentaire à l’IA. Imaginez un wrapper avec lequel vous pouvez demander à une IA des éléments liés à un site Web ou à un document que vous consultez. Eh bien, dans ce cas, cette couche supplémentaire donnera au modèle ces informations sur ce que vous voyez. Cela peut même contribuer à la confidentialité en divulguant des données sensibles.
Ils peuvent également contrôler et filtrer les sorties ou les réponses de l’IA. Ils peuvent le faire en recherchant et en filtrant les réponses incorrectes, ou en ajustant les réponses du modèle de base à un ton spécifique. Une autre chose qu'ils peuvent faire est d'ajouter une logique métier supplémentaire à l'IA, comme des validations, des règles de sécurité supplémentaires ou une personnalisation basée sur les utilisateurs.
Une autre chose qu'ils peuvent faire est d'orchestrer et d'organiser le travail de plusieurs modèles ou outils dans un flux automatisé. Allez, vous demandez quelque chose au wrapper, et dans son flux de travail, il organise les requêtes vers différents modèles pour générer la réponse avec chacun d'eux, et également effectuer des recherches sur Internet, dans des bases de données ou lire des fichiers.
Enfin, les wrappers peuvent également intégrer un modèle d’intelligence artificielle dans les systèmes existants. De plus, ils peuvent améliorer l'expérience utilisateur en ajoutant des boutons à une IA, des modèles ou des flux guidés. De même, ils peuvent spécialiser l’IA dans un cas d’utilisation spécifique, comme la programmation, la rédaction d’e-mails, etc.
Dans les bases de Simseo | Les meilleures invites pour économiser des heures de travail et effectuer vos tâches avec ChatGPT, Gemini, Copilot ou autre intelligence artificielle
